Post-Baccalaureate Students

Students with a baccalaureate degree who wish to attend UNI as an undergraduate student, will need to fill out and electronically submit the Post Baccalaureate Application for Admission. Additional information regarding returning to UNI can be found by visiting the Office of Admissions.

Students who have a recognized baccalaureate degree may return to the University of Northern Iowa as an undergraduate student to pursue one of the following programs:

  • Second baccalaureate degree
  • Teacher licensure
  • Non-degree undergraduate with baccalaureate degree

Second Baccalaureate Degree

This requires submission of official transcripts from all colleges and universities attended since your last enrollment at UNI. With this category, a student will be classified as a senior.


Teacher Licensure

This is for acquiring original licensure or adding new endorsements through UNI recommendation - NOT for renewals or Board of Education Examiners minimum requirements. This may require admission to Teacher Education and submission of official transcripts from all colleges and universities attended since your last enrollment at UNI. This program requires the completion of a minimum of 12 semester hours at the University of Northern Iowa before recommendation to the Board of Educational Examiners will be made. With this category, you will be classified as a senior for registration purposes.


Non-Degree Undergraduate with Baccalaureate Degree

Including license renewal and Board of Educational Examiners minimum requirements. With this category, you will be considered an unclassified student. This program requires verification of a previous Baccalaureate Degree or submission of official transcripts from a degree-granting institution. 

If you are interested in pursuing an additional major after completing a UNI Baccalaureate degree, you must complete the Subsequent Major Form after applying as a Non-Degree Seeking student through the Office of Admissions.
